Request for Applications 00-1:
Effects of Diesel Exhaust and Other Particles on the Exacerbation of Asthma and Other
Allergic Diseases
Request for Application (RFA) 00-1 solicits applications for research to (1) investigate
whether exposure to diesel exhaust particles (DEP) is associated with exacerbation of
asthma and other allergic diseases; (2) determine whether particulate matter from other
sources (for example gasoline engines, natural gas engines, power plants, crustal dust,
etc.) has effects similar to those induced by DEP; and (3) investigate the mechanisms that
may lead to the effects observed.

Request for Applications 00-2:
Walter A. Rosenblith New Investigator Award
The purpose of this award is to bring new, creative investigators into active research
on the health effects of air pollution. It will provide three years of funding for a small
project relevant to HEIs research interests to a new investigator with outstanding
promise at the Assistant Professor or equivalent level. For information on HEIs
current research priorities, applicants should consult Appendix A. HEI expects to provide
one award from this RFA this year and to continue the award on an annual basis. The
evaluation process for these applications will consider the qualifications and background
of the applicant, the quality and relevance of the research proposal, and the research
environment of the applicant.

Request for Preliminary Applications 00-3:
Health Effects of Air Pollution
The Request for Preliminary Applications 00-3 provides an application mechanism for
investigators whose area of interest falls outside the topics targeted in other current
research requests, but is relevant to HEIs current priorities. For information on
HEIs current priorities, applicants should consult Appendix A.
This year we have changed the Preliminary Application process in that the HEI Research
Committee will be reviewing Preliminary Applications only once during the next year. The
deadline for submission is August 31, 2001. The HEI Research Committee
will review them at its fall 2001 meeting and request full applications for those
considered most relevant to the needs of the Institute.
